How Much Did Travis Smyth Win At The International Series Japan?

Travis Smyth after winning the International Series Japan.

The race for a LIV Golf card is on via the Asian Tour's International Series, with the first of eight events this season having taken place in Japan.

Once of the big incentives for many pros teeing it up in the International Series is the chance to secure their LIV Golf card via its season-long rankings, with further tournaments scheduled in Asia, and one in north Africa, alongside regular tour events.

Points are on offer for those who make the cut at International Series tournaments, and they go towards a running total with the top two pros who do not already hold LIV status for 2027 earning their spot on LIV.

At Chiba's Caledonian Golf Club, Travis Smyth got off to the best possible start with that endeavor when he made a 72nd-hole eagle to claim a thrilling victory.

As well as 180 points to top the early rankings, Smyth also earns substantial prize money thanks to his victory.

The International Series Japan had an overall prize fund of $2m, and Smyth, who followed fellow Australian Lucas Herbert as champion, earns $360,000.

Ryosuke Kinoshita was one of two players to finish runner-up (Image credit: Getty Images)

Two players finished runner-up - Pavit Tangkamolprasert and Ryosuke Kinoshita. As a result, the pair banked $173,000 apiece.
